Traffic generation can be a persistent challenge for many online ventures . Have you encountered traffic platforms ? These specialized solutions offer a possible way to generate substantial website https://siobhanfiuf251615.wikievia.com/11327922/unlock_elite_traffic_a_deep_dive_into_traffic_exchanges